Also, do Sonicare brush heads fit all models?
Philips Sonicare brush heads are interchangeable with all Sonicare power toothbrush handles, except PowerUp and Essence. All Philips Sonicare brush heads click on and off the brush handle for a secure fit and easy maintenance and cleaning.

Also asked, what heads fit my Sonicare?
There are two types of brush heads: Snap/Click on and Twist/Screw on. The snap on or click on brush heads are compatible with most of our rechargeable Sonicare Toothbrush handles. These will fit all Philips Sonicare toothbrush handles except for the PowerUp Battery and Essence model.
Are Sonicare chargers interchangeable?
Philips Sonicare chargers are designed to fit the matching toothbrush handle, however, some models are interchangeable.

Name brand brush heads, used with the toothbrush, will emit a whine or buzz. Generics will have a clatter as the parts collide against each other imprecisely, mixed in with the buzz. That clatter represents less precise cleaning of your teeth. So no, generics are not as good as name brand “Genuine Sonicare”.Can you use Oral B heads on Sonicare?

Can I leave my Philips Sonicare Toothbrush on the charger? You can always keep your Philips Sonicare Toothbrush on a plugged-in charger between brushings. This will not affect the battery lifespan of your toothbrush.What do the symbols mean on Sonicare toothbrush heads?
When the Philips Sonicare ExpertClean is removed from the charger, the battery light(s) on the bottom of the handle will indicate the status of the battery: If you see 3 solid green lights: Battery is full. If you see 2 solid green lights: Battery is half-full. If you see 1 solid green light: Batter is low.What is the best Sonicare toothbrush head?
